Coming soon: Users can seamlessly share apps and Microsoft 365 Copilot agents in Microsoft Teams chats and channels. A Microsoft 365 Copilot license is not required to share apps and agents, but a Microsoft 365 Copilot is required to use apps and agents.

This message applies to Teams for Windows desktop, Mac desktop, Teams on the web, and Teams for Android/iOS.

When this will happen:

Targeted Release: We will begin rolling out mid-December 2024 and expect to complete by early January 2025.

General Availability (Worldwide): We will begin rolling out early January 2025 and expect to complete by late January 2025.

How this will affect your organization:

After this rollout, users will experience:

  • New detailed cards for shared Copilot agents and apps
  • Shortened URLs for shared links
  • The developer’s name and branding icon on app cards
  • App details in short description in cards
  • Ability to dismiss cards while pasting a link in compose mode
  • Ability to right click and share apps from the left app bar
  • Ability to share from an app header
  • An updated sharing experience with Share and Copy link in the same window
  • Shared Copilot agents created from the embedded agent builder in Teams can now be acquired from Teams and used in the Copilot app within Teams.

This change will be on by default.

What you need to do to prepare:

This rollout will happen automatically by the specified date with no admin action required before the rollout. Review your current configuration to determine the impact for your organization. You may want to notify your users about this change and update any relevant documentation.
